In this episode of The Art of Living Well Podcast®, hosts Marnie Dachis Marmet and Stephanie May Potter sit down with Harlan Cohen, a renowned speaker and best-selling author, known for his work guiding parents and students through the challenges of high school and college. Together, they explore how to handle rejection, manage change, and nurture curiosity in both ourselves and our children.

Harlan shares powerful insights on his own journey of overcoming adversity, including the unexpected lessons learned during his time at the University of Wisconsin. He also discusses the concept of "uninhibited curiosity" and how it can help both parents and students navigate life's transitions with more resilience and less fear.

Whether you’re a parent of a high schooler, a college student, or someone navigating a big life change, this conversation will leave you with practical tools for embracing discomfort and moving forward with confidence.

What You’ll Learn in This Episode:

  • The importance of embracing rejection and why it's a natural part of growth

  • How to reframe failure and help your children navigate their own challenges

  • The power of uninhibited curiosity in fostering personal and professional growth

  • Practical advice for parents on how to support their kids during tough transitions

  • Harlan's unique perspective on the changing landscape of higher education and career paths

Noteworthy Quotes from the Episode:

  • "Everything’s going to be okay—it always turns out to be okay." – Harlan Cohen

  • "Growth is so scary because we’re so afraid of disappointing ourselves, so afraid of rejection and shame." – Harlan Cohen

  • "Living well is about being kind to yourself and having compassionate empathy." – Harlan Cohen

  • "Rejection is not something we have to be afraid of. We can learn from it." – Harlan Cohen
